#freecad WHY is it even a possibility that a pad of a simple sketch in a separate body would somehow just include a "phantom" copy of the feature the sketch is attached to. how does this even happen?!
(yes this is fixed by attaching to a ShapeBinder, not directly to a different body, but like.. why is this the failure mode? maybe just don't allow direct attaching if it's going to produce jank)

Alright, M3, M4, M5, M6, and M8 parameters for the rib thread macro all look good after testing.
The same parameters can be used for both vertical and horizontal orientation. For horizontal rib threads, ensure they are rotated so there is no unsupported rib floating at the top.
